// Broker upgrade notes for plugin authors:
// Quillbus 4.x replaces the legacy 3.x wire protocol. Plugins must
// construct the client with explicit protocol negotiation enabled,
// or connections to the Larkfield cluster will be silently downgraded
// and dropped after 30s. Topic names are unchanged. For local testing
// against the sandbox broker, authenticate with the key below.

API key for bafof-bagaf: qvz2-qi

Hey Marisol — handing off the doc linter (Prosewright) before I'm out next week. It's stable on the Kettleford docs repo; the only flaky bit is the heading-depth rule, which I've set to warn instead of error until the style guide folks decide. Releases just need the linter pinned to the same version as CI, otherwise you'll get phantom diffs. Nothing else is exciting. For the release cut, make sure the runtime picks up the config exactly as below.

settings of fafog-haduf:
ZORIX_PIN=4648
ZORIX_METRICS_HOST=metrics.zorix.paliqsys.corp
ZORIX_LOG_LEVEL=info
ZORIX_TENANT=druix

Quarterly Planning Note — Divestiture of the Coastal Tooling Unit

For the finance team: the sale of the Coastal Tooling unit to Pellmark Industries remains on track for close in Q3. Please finalize the carve-out balance sheet, reconcile intercompany positions, and prepare the working-capital adjustment schedule by month-end. Audit support requests should be prioritized. For planning purposes, note the following sensitive item:

internal memo for hawef-kahif: The finance team signed off on a budget of $25.9 million for Project Sorox. The renewal with Pelokek Logistics closes at $51.7 million a year, 52 percent below the last contract.

Handover — Tilecask cache layer (for Priya's sync notes)

I've stabilized the tile-rendering cache after last week's eviction storm. Root cause was the warm-up job repopulating zoom levels 12–16 in one burst, which evicted the hot coastal tiles. I've staggered the warm-up and capped per-shard fill rate. Watch hit ratio on the Norgate shard; below 85% means the cap is too aggressive. The cache now runs with the following settings.

service settings:
PRAWYN_PIN=9848
PRAWYN_METRICS_HOST=metrics.prawyn.lumicworks.corp
PRAWYN_LOG_LEVEL=warn
PRAWYN_TENANT=pelius